Introduction: Dengue Hemorrhagic Fever disease is a disease caused by DEN-1, DEN-2, DEN-3, or DEN-4 viruses. This disease can be transmitted by Aedes aegypti and Aedes albopictus mosquitoes which carry the dengue virus from other DHF sufferers. DHF is still an important public health problem. Ae. aegypti prefers residential areas and lays their eggs in air reservoirs. Some of the water sources used by the people of Indonesia are PAM water, well water, and rain water. This study aims to determine the hatchability of Ae. aegypti in three types of air so that it is expected to provide information to the public about potential breeding places for Ae. aegypti take precautions and eradication of breeding sites.
Methods: This research is an experimental study with Post Test Only with Control Group Design. The sample in this study was the eggs of Ae. aegypti as well as water samples (well water, rain water, and PAM water).
Results: The type of well water is the type of water with the highest number of hatching, which is 48 grains. The second order is for the type of rain water, which is 14 grains, then the type of PAM water is 5 grains, and the least is distilled water, which is 4 grains. The hatchability of well water is 26.66%, rain water is 7.77%, PAM water is 2.7%, and distilled water is 2.22%.
Conclusion: The type of well water is the type of water with the highest number of hatching, which is 48 grains. And obtained a significant difference in hatchability of Ae. aegypti in three types of water.
